Transaction 68524f38f12d4064d21d8d3e4ec9aa9bf670decb8e1dccf7e0e1206290510875
1 Input
1 Output
-
68524f38f12d4064d21d8d3e4ec9aa9bf670decb8e1dccf7e0e1206290510875:0
- value
- 577027
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 76881e94f8f51c9e0ab32c4bcb33e9b2077d924ae3256120603f68b0c1afadcc
- address
- bc1pw6ypa98c75wfuz4n939ukvlfkgrhmyj2uvjkzgrq8a5tpsd04hxq30qs9z